USF 2, Illinois State 1
Single runs in both the first and second innings proved to be the difference as USF opened 2019 with a 2-1 victory at home over Illinois State. AnaMarie Bruni was 2-for-3 in the win with three stolen bases, and scored the first run of the season on Lindsey Devitt’s RBI groundout in the bottom of the first inning. After Illinois State briefly tied the game with a run in the top of the second, Bethaney Kean’s solo homer in the bottom of the second would give the Bulls the lead they would not give up. Nicole Doyle earned the win in the circle, allowing two hits and the one run in 3 2/3 innings of work while striking out three batters. USF continues its opening weekend on Friday night, when the Bulls host No. 6 Arizona.
Ole Miss 3, UCF 0
In their 2019 season opener, UCF fell to Ole Miss 3-0 on Thursday night. Tamesha Glover led the way offensively for the Knights, going 2-for-2 at the plate with a walk. Alea White took the loss in the circle after tossing complete game giving up three runs on six hits and four strikeouts. Defensively, catcher Cassady Brewer caught a runner stealing for the 25th time of her career. The Knights are back in action on Friday night when they will take on No. 21 Minnesota.
LSU 19, Tulsa 1
Morgan Neal and Haley Meinen each recorded a hit as Tulsa opened the season with a 19-1 loss at LSU on Thursday night. Alexis Perry drove in Julia Hollingsworth in the top of the first inning for the only Golden Hurricane run in the loss. Tulsa continues its opening weekend of action with pair of games on Friday, taking on Bucknell in the afternoon before a second matchup with LSU tomorrow night.
